OPNAV INSTRUCTION 5510.163A
From: Chief of Naval Operations
Subj: CONTROL OF NAVAL RESERVE PERSONNEL INVOLVEMENT IN NAVAL
NUCLEAR PROPULSION MATTERS
Ref: (a) 10 CFR 1016
(b) OPNAVINST N9210.3
(c) 50 USC
(d) NAVSEAINST 9210.4C
1. Purpose. To establish Navy policy and guidance concerning involvement in naval nuclear
propulsion matters by personnel in the Naval Reserve, other than those on active duty, and
access by such personnel to Naval Nuclear Propulsion Information (NNPI) and nuclear
propulsion plant requirement and spaces.
2. Cancellation. OPNAVINST 5510.163.
3. Scope and Applicability. This instruction applies to all Navy commands and facilities
(including nuclear powered warships) that handle or process NNPI and have personnel in the
Selected Reserve and the Individual Ready Reserve performing their reserve duties.
4. Background. Access to NNPI or nuclear propulsion plant equipment and spaces is closely
controlled owing to military sensitivity and the need to ensure that those personnel who perform
work on nuclear propulsion matters have the requisite training, experience and knowledge.
Reference (a) establishes standards for the protection of Restricted Data (RD). Reference (b)
defines NNPI in detail and provides a detailed description of the principles that govern access to
NNPI. Reference (c) §2406 sets forth the basic responsibilities of the Director, Naval Nuclear
Propulsion including the selection and assignment of personnel who are to perform naval nuclear
propulsion work. Reference (d) discusses changes, repairs and modifications to the propulsion
plant of nuclear powered warships and categorizes propulsion plant systems and equipment as
reactor plant and non-reactor plant.
